PowerChina said it has completed about 70% of the Dongshan Xingchen Offshore Photovoltaic Power Station near Zhangzhou, China's Fujian province. The 180 MW project, covering 203 hectares, will be ...
Ocean Sun AS’s Magat Floating Solar pilot project in the Philippines, despite sustaining structural damage from Typhoon Nika, has demonstrated strong resilience and design improvements over its 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results